feat: Implement Walmart scraper and integrate with existing architecture

- Added Walmart scraper to scrape product data from Walmart.com, including category pages and product details.
- Introduced a stealth browser module to handle bot protection and improve scraping reliability.
- Created a SQLite database for tracking product history, price changes, stock events, and user favorites.
- Developed a Discord bot for user interaction, allowing location setting and stock checking at local stores.
- Implemented a favorites system to manage priority products and categories with custom notification settings.
- Added news aggregation module to fetch and analyze Pokemon TCG news from various sources.
- Created tools for API discovery and monitoring, including a backend monitor for detecting new products.
- Added unit tests for database operations, product filtering, and API endpoints to ensure functionality.
- Enhanced existing modules with improved error handling and logging for better maintainability.
